Most current in vivo models use Eimeria as predisposing aspect. However, many designs only end up in a limited range pets with abdominal necrosis. This research describes the necrotic enteritis incidence and seriousness making use of 2 previously explained experimental designs different within the time point and frequency of Eimeria administration single late and early repeated Eimeria administration models. In an in vivo design for which Clostridium perfringens is administered at 3 successive days between time 18 and 20 of age, wild birds belonging to the single belated Eimeria administration routine obtained just one administration of a tenfold dosage of a live attenuated Eimeria vaccine regarding the 2nd day’s C. perfringens challenge. Broilers of the early repeated administration regimen were inoculated with similar Eimeria vaccine 4 and 2 d before the start of botanical medicine C. perfringens challenge. Early continued coccidial administration resulted in a significant increase in typical necrotic lesion rating (value 3.26) as compared with an individual late Eimeria administration regimen (value 1.2). In addition, the sheer number of necrotic enteritis-positive creatures was dramatically higher into the team that received the first consistent coccidial administration. Solitary Eimeria management during C. perfringens challenge led to a skewed circulation of lesion scoring with hardly any wild birds within the high rating categories. A far more centered distribution had been obtained with all the very early consistent Eimeria administration regimen, having findings in almost every lesion rating group. These conclusions allow better standardization of a subclinical necrotic enteritis model and reduction of the necessary variety of experimental animals.In this research, the effects of omega-3 fatty acids on egg manufacturing, nutritional elements digestibility, eggs yolk lipid peroxidation, and abdominal morphology in laying hens under physiological stress had been examined. Ninety-six 35-wk-old Lohmann LSL-Lite laying hens were used in 2 × 3 factorial arrangement with 2 levels of dexamethasone (DEX) (0 and 1.5 mg/kg associated with diet) and 3 quantities of omega-3 efas (0, 0.24, or 0.48percent for the diet) in an entirely randomized design. At 41 wk of age, the worries groups were continuously given with a DEX 1.5 mg/kg diet for 1 wk. Egg production, egg mass, feed consumption, egg body weight, and feed conversion proportion were recorded. In inclusion, the AME, digestibility of CP, crude fat (CF), and organic matter were measured throughout the tension induction duration. At the conclusion of 41 wk of age, malondialdehyde and cholesterol levels concentrations in the egg yolk and abdominal morphology had been investigated. The results showed that egg manufacturing, egg size (P less then 0.0001), egg fat (P = 0.043), and BW (P = 0.0005) had been low in DEX levels. Feed intake was paid off because of the connection between DEX and omega-3 fatty acid (P = 0.042). Malondialdehyde value (P = 0.002) and cholesterol focus (P = 0.001) in egg yolk increased by DEX administration. The mixture of DEX administration and omega-3 essential fatty acids supplementation ended up being found in the indices of intestinal morphology such as for example villus height and width and crypt depth (P less then 0.05). Management of DEX decreased the CP digestibility (P less then 0.0001) and AME (P = 0.006). Digestibility of CF and AME in the set of 0.48% omega-3 efas were higher (P less then 0.05) than those of 0 and 0.24%. In conclusion, we found that diet omega 3 efas had beneficial effects on gut morphology and nutrient digestibility in laying hens under physiological tension.
